The setting sun reflected off the rearview mirror, piercing through Zee’s sunglasses as he and Tori curved up the canyon interstate toward her home. He reached up and pressed the button to raise the mirror slightly, preventing the potent rays from blinding him into an accident.

He kept his gaze forward, allowing Tori’s eyes to study his profile. Was she as attracted to him as he was to her? Not possible. He had to figure something out to get his impulses under control. His thoughts, that she so eagerly wanted to explore, needed to be refocused.

“How’s my make-up holding up?” he questioned.

“Perfect. Thank you for leaving it on for Ethan and Gussie. Is it starting to stiffen, like a clay face mask?”

“Does a clay face mask feel like all the blood is being sucked out of your skin, and if you were to smile, then all that dried blood would crumble into millions of pieces?”

“I guess.”

“Then, yes, it feels like a clay face mask.”

“Are you into those post-apocalyptic zombie shows?”

“You’re not?” he said, displaying offense.

She laughed. He still had it. He could make her laugh. But could he make her want to be more than best platonic friends? That remained to be seen.

The sun had completely set before they turned up Tori’s driveway.

“Thanks for getting me home in time to put Ethan down. If he’s not asleep by nine thirty, he has a difficult time getting up for school. It’s like waking a sleeping bear.”

“I can see why you’d steer clear of having a bear to breakfast. But seriously, Ethan’s a great kid. You’ve done a fine job raising him.”

“Thanks, he loves playing basketball with you. Oh…I forgot, he wanted you to come in and shoot a few hoops with him tonight. Would that be okay?”

Zee gazed down at his legs. If he ran on a basketball court right now he’d look like an inebriated chicken. His overworked muscles were starting to feel the pain of his climb.

Tori shuffled in her seat. “It’s okay. I know it’s been a long day. You don’t need to come in.”

“Are you kidding? I’d love to. I just paused to think of a good game plan.”

Her face warmed like an angel, smiling that same smile she’d given him in the lodge, but this time he had to refrain from laughing because she resembled a hissing cat. His energy level went from two to two thousand. He suddenly had the stamina to climb that cliff face again. He was more than hooked on this girl. She could ask him to steal the crown jewels with that smile, and he’d be on the next plane to London.

They entered the house to the scent of sweetened vanilla and the smooth, jazzy tunes of Harry Connick Jr.

“Mom!” Ethan bounced down the hall to them. “What the heck! That’s awesome.”

Tori took a bow. “Do I look like Midnight?”

“Zach’s cat? Almost. Midnight’s white. Maybe when you’re old, you’ll look like Midnight.”

“Let’s hope I don’t have long, white whiskers coming out of my chin,” she said, tickling her chin with her fingertips.
